  • Minivan rental costs fluctuate with demand. Peak travel periods like summer holidays and school breaks drive rates up. Booking during off-peak times or midweek reduces cost exposure.

        Minivan rentals are no longer the steady, predictable expense once thought. With rising demand, seasonal fluctuations, and newer alternative providers entering the space, the actual cost to rent a minivan has seen surprising variances—prices that often differ from what users expect at first glance. This isn’t just about booking late or traveling off-season; it’s about strategic decisions that can unlock significant savings.

        Real-world examples confirm this. A family planning a week-long coastal road trip outside peak season recently saved $400 by shifting travel dates and using a regional booking platform that surfaced discounted midweek deals. Another traveler, aware that weekend last-minute bookings spike, opted for an early Tuesday pickup—cutting expenses significantly.

        Travel habits are evolving quickly, and so are rental expectations. Pandemic-era caution gave way to a surge in road trips, especially for family travel and road-based adventures—minivans remaining a top choice due to space and practicality. But beneath this growth sits a pricing environment under pressure. Inventory remains tight in key destinations, inflation impacts delivery costs, and providers adjust rates dynamically. These shifts have sparked widespread curiosity—drivers now ask tougher questions about value, hidden fees, and when it’s worth waiting.

        What makes these savings possible is not magic—it’s logistics and pricing intelligence in action. Many rentals operate on dynamic pricing models, adjusting rates in real time based on demand, occupancy, and even local events. This flexibility allows providers to offer competitive rates during low-demand periods—moments travelers often overlook.
